Durga Jot in context
With 809 people at the 2011 Census, Durga Jot was the 1109th most populous of its district's 2505 villages, below the district average of 958.
Literacy stood at 38.14%, 20.2 points below the district's rural average of 58.35%.
The sex ratio was 851 women per 1,000 men (128 below the district's rural figure of 979).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 952, 29 above the rural national 923.
